Abstract

본 발명은 친환경 환풍기에 관한 것으로, 환풍팬을 회전작동시켜서 실내 공기를 외부로 배출시키는 방법으로 실내를 환기하도록 구성된 환풍기에 있어서,
상기 환풍팬의 케이스 이면에 착탈가능하게 부착되는 필터케이스를 구비하고 있으며,
상기 필터케이스의 내부에는 환풍팬의 회전작동에 의해 흡입되는 공기에 포함되어 있는 먼지와 같은 이물질을 여과하는 프리필터와, 공기에 포함되어 있는 유해물질을 자외선으로 살균처리하는 블랙라이트등과, 공기에 포함되어 있는 유해물질을 산화분해하는 기능을 가지고 있는 허니컴구조의 광촉매필터가 3단 구조로 형성되어 있는 것을 특징으로 하는 발명이다.
The present invention relates to an eco-friendly ventilator, the ventilator configured to ventilate the room by a method of discharging the indoor air to the outside by rotating the ventilation fan,
It is provided with a filter case detachably attached to the back of the case of the ventilation fan,
Inside the filter case, a pre-filter for filtering foreign substances such as dust contained in the air sucked by the rotation operation of the fan, a black light for sterilizing harmful substances contained in the air with ultraviolet rays, and the like. The invention is characterized in that the honeycomb photocatalyst filter having a function of oxidatively decomposing harmful substances contained in the three-stage structure.

Description

친환경 환풍기{Eco ventilator}Eco-ventilator {Eco ventilator}

본 발명은 친환경 환풍기에 관한 것으로, 좀더 상세하게는 밀폐된 실내의 오염된 공기에서 먼지, 냄새 등을 제거 및 탈취함과 동시에 살균처리하여 깨끗하게 정화된 공기를 실외로 배출시키도록 함으로써 깨끗하고 신선한 대기환경을 유지시킬 수 있도록 하는 친환경 환풍기에 관한 것이다.
The present invention relates to an environment-friendly ventilator, and more particularly, to a ventilator for an environmentally friendly air conditioner, which removes and deodorizes dust and odors from the contaminated air in a closed room, To an environment-friendly ventilator that can maintain the environment.

일반적으로 환풍기는 실내의 오염된 공기를 깨끗한 공기로 바꾸어주는 장치로서, 실내의 오염된 공기를 실외로 배출시키고 외부의 깨끗한 공기가 실내로 유입되게 하는 용도로 사용되고 있다.Generally, a ventilator is a device that turns contaminated air in a room into clean air, and is used for discharging polluted air in the room to the outside, and for allowing clean air to flow into the room.

그런데, 일반 주택이 밀집되어 있는 지역이나 각종 업종이 밀집되어 있는 상가 등에서 주방에서 오염된 공기를 환기시키거나 또는 화장실 내부를 환기시키기 위해 환풍기를 가동시킬 경우 환풍기를 통해 배출되는 오염된 공기가 밀집되어 있는 이웃의 실내로 유입되는 문제가 발생되고 있으며, 특히 환풍기를 통해 배출되는 오염된 공기가 대기환경을 오염시키게 되어 이웃의 사람들의 건강을 해치게 된다는 것이 문제점으로 지적되고 있는 실정이다.
However, when the ventilator is operated to ventilate the contaminated air in the kitchen or to ventilate the inside of a densely populated area or a business district where various types of businesses are concentrated, polluted air discharged through the ventilator is densely packed There is a problem in that the polluted air discharged through the ventilator contaminates the air environment and harms the health of the neighboring people.

본 발명은 상기와 같은 문제점을 해결하기 위하여 제안된 것으로, 실내의 공기를 실외의 신선한 공기로 환기시킴과 동시에 실외에는 먼지, 냄새가 제거, 탈취되고 살균처리된 공기를 배출시키도록 함으로써 실내의 오염된 공기를 친환경적으로 환기시킬 수 있도록 하는데 목적을 두고 발명한 것이다.
Disclosure of Invention Technical Problem [8] Accordingly, the present invention has been made in order to solve the above-mentioned problems, and it is an object of the present invention to provide an air conditioner which is capable of ventilating indoor air with fresh air outdoors and removing dust, odor, The air can be ventilated in an environmentally friendly manner.

본 발명은 상기와 같은 목적을 구현하기 위한 수단으로서,The present invention, as a means for realizing the above object,

환풍팬을 회전작동시켜서 실내 공기를 외부로 배출시키는 방법으로 실내를 환기하도록 구성된 환풍기에 있어서,The ventilator is configured to ventilate the room by rotating the ventilating fan to discharge the indoor air to the outside,

상기 환풍기는, The ventilator,

상기 환풍팬의 케이스 이면에 착탈가능하게 부착되는 필터케이스를 구비하고 있으며,And a filter case detachably attached to the back surface of the case of the ventilation fan,

상기 필터케이스의 내부에는 환풍팬의 회전작동에 의해 흡입되는 공기에 포함되어 있는 먼지와 같은 이물질을 여과하는 프리필터와, 공기에 포함되어 있는 유해물질을 자외선으로 살균처리하는 블랙라이트등과, 공기에 포함되어 있는 유해물질을 산화분해하는 기능을 가지고 있는 허니컴구조의 광촉매필터가 3단 구조로 형성되어 있는 것을 특징으로 한다.Inside the filter case, a pre-filter for filtering foreign substances such as dust contained in the air sucked by the rotation operation of the fan, a black light for sterilizing harmful substances contained in the air with ultraviolet rays, and the like. The honeycomb photocatalyst filter having a function of oxidatively decomposing harmful substances contained in is characterized in that it is formed in a three-stage structure.

또한, 상기 필터케이스의 내부에는 프리필터, 블랙라이트등, 광촉매필터와 함께 이산화규소, 게르마늄 및 탄소 성분으로 구성된 분말이 펠릿(pellet)상으로 압축 성형되어 악취와 같은 냄새를 탈취 정화하는 기능을 가진 셀라이트(celite) 필터를 포함하여 4단 구조로 형성하여서 된 것을 특징으로 한다.
In addition, the filter case has a function of deodorizing and purifying odors such as odors by compressing and molding a powder composed of silicon dioxide, germanium and carbon components together with a photocatalyst filter such as a pre-filter, black light, etc. into a pellet. It is characterized by being formed in a four-stage structure, including a celite filter.

본 발명에 의하면 오염된 실내의 공기에서 먼지 등의 이물질은 프리필터에서 여과처리 하고, 공기에 포함되어 있는 유해물질은 블랙라이트등에서 발광하는 자외선으로 살균처리됨과 동시에 광촉매필터는 공기에 포함되어 있는 유해물질을 산화분해 처리하며, 또한 셀라이트필터는 공기와 함께 배출되는 악취 등의 냄새를 탈취하게 되어 환풍기에서 배출되는 공기는 깨끗하게 정화된 상태가 되므로 오염된 실내를 환기시키기 위해 환풍기를 작동시킬 때에는 대기환경을 오염시키지 않고 친환경적으로 실내를 환기시킬 수 있도록 하는 효과가 있는 것이다.
According to the present invention, foreign matters such as dust in the air in a contaminated room are filtered by a pre-filter, and harmful substances contained in air are sterilized by ultraviolet rays emitted from black light or the like, and at the same time, the photo- In addition, the Celite filter removes the odor of odor and the like discharged together with the air, so that the air discharged from the ventilator is cleanly cleaned. Therefore, when operating the ventilator to ventilate the contaminated room, It is possible to ventilate the room environmentally without polluting the environment.

본 발명에 의한 친환경 환풍기에 대한 구체적인 실시예를 첨부한 도면에 따라서 상세히 설명하면 다음과 같다.D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S Hereinafter, embodiments of an environment-friendly ventilator according to the present invention will be described in detail with reference to the accompanying drawings.

도 1의 도시는 본 발명의 일실시예의 친환경 환풍기 단면도로서, 상기 환풍기(1)는 환풍팬(21)이 회전가능하게 장착된 케이스(2)와, 상기 케이스(2)의 이면에 착탈가능하게 장착 조립되는 필터케이스(3)로 구성되어 있다.1 is a cross-sectional view of an environment-friendly ventilator according to an embodiment of the present invention. The ventilator 1 includes a case 2 in which a ventilating fan 21 is rotatably mounted, And a filter case 3 to be mounted and assembled.

상기 케이스(2)의 전면(22)은 환풍팬(21)의 회전작동으로 공기가 저항없이 잘 송풍될 수 있도록 철망구조로 형성되어 있으며, 상기 케이스(2)의 이면(23)은 환풍팬(21)의 회전작동으로 필터케이스(3)를 통해 공기가 잘 흡입될 수 있으며, 도한 상기 필터케이스(3)를 견고하게 지지 또는 부착시킬 수 있는 철망구조 내지 타공된 철판구조로 형성되어 있다.The front surface 22 of the case 2 is formed by a wire mesh structure so that the air can be blown well without resistance by the rotation operation of the ventilation fan 21. The back surface 23 of the case 2 is connected to the ventilation fan 21 can be well sucked in through the filter case 3 and can be firmly supported or attached to the filter case 3 by a rotating operation of the filter case 3.

상기 필터케이스(3)의 내부에는 공기유입측(31)에서부터 케이스(2)의 이면을 향해 프리필터(4), 블랙라이트등(5 : Black light), 광촉매필터(6) 등이 차례대로 위치하도록 3단 구조로 장착되어 있다.A pre-filter 4, a black light, etc. (5: Black light), a photocatalytic filter 6, and the like are sequentially disposed in the interior of the filter case 3 from the air inflow side 31 toward the back side of the case 2 It is equipped with a three-stage structure.

상기 필터케이스(3)의 공기유입측(31)에는 공기가 잘 유입될 수 있도록 철망구조 내지 타공구조가 형성되어 있다.The air inlet side (31) of the filter case (3) is formed with a wire mesh structure or a piercing structure so that air can flow well.

상기 필터케이스(3)의 공기유입측(31)에 근접하도록 장착된 프리필터(4)는 부직포 등으로 구성되어 공기 중에 포함되어 있는 먼지와 같은 이물질을 여과하는 기능을 담당하게 되며, 상기 프리필터(4) 다음으로 장착되는 블랙라이트등(5)은 자외선을 발광하여 공기를 살균처리하는 기능을 가지고 있으며, 상기 블랙라이트등(5) 다음으로 케이스(2)의 이면(23)에 근접하게 장착되는 광촉매필터(6)는 허니컴 구조로 형성되어 공기에 포함되어 있는 유해물질을 산화분해하는 기능을 가지고 있다.The prefilter 4 attached to the air inlet side 31 of the filter case 3 is formed of a nonwoven fabric or the like to filter foreign matters such as dust contained in the air, (4) The black light lamp 5 to be mounted next has a function of sterilizing the air by emitting ultraviolet rays. The black light lamp 5 is mounted next to the rear surface 23 of the case 2 The photocatalyst filter 6 is formed of a honeycomb structure and has a function of oxidizing and decomposing harmful substances contained in air.

도 2의 도시는 본 발명의 다른 실시예의 친환경 환풍기를 나타낸 단면도로서, 상기 환풍기(1)는 전술한 실시예와 마찬가지로 환풍팬(21)이 장착된 케이스(2)와, 상기 케이스(2)의 이면(23)에 착탈가능하게 장착되는 필터케이스(3)로 구성되어 있는데, 상기 필터케이스(3)의 내부에는 공기유입측(31)에서부터 케이스(2)의 이면(23)을 향해 프리필터(4), 블랙라이트등(5), 광촉매필터(6) 및 셀라이트 필터(7 : Celite filter) 등이 차례대로 장착되는 4단 구조로 형성되어 있다.2 is a cross-sectional view showing an environment-friendly ventilator according to another embodiment of the present invention. The ventilator 1 includes a case 2 in which a ventilating fan 21 is mounted, And a filter case 3 detachably mounted on the rear surface 23 of the case 2. The filter case 3 is provided with a prefilter (not shown) extending from the air inflow side 31 toward the rear surface 23 of the case 2 4 structure in which a black light or the like 5, a photocatalytic filter 6, and a Celite filter 7 are sequentially mounted.

상기 프리필터(4), 블랙라이트등(5), 광촉매필터(6)는 전술한 실시예와 같은 기능을 가지고 있으며, 상기 셀라이트 필터(5)의 경우는 이산화규소, 게르마늄, 탄소 성분이 혼합 구성된 분말을 펠릿(pellet)상으로 압축 성형된 것으로서, 공기와 함께 배출되는 악취 등의 냄새를 탈취 및 정화하는 기능을 가지고 있다.
The pre-filter 4, the black light 5, and the photocatalytic filter 6 have the same functions as those in the above embodiment. In the case of the Celite filter 5, the silicon dioxide, germanium, And has a function of deodorizing and purifying the smell of odor and the like discharged together with air as a result of compression molding of the powder constituted in a pellet form.

이와 같이 구성된 본 발명의 작용에 대하여 설명하면 다음과 같다.The operation of the present invention will be described below.

본 발명의 환풍기(1)는 환풍팬(21)이 장착된 케이스(2)의 전면(22)은 실외로 노출되고 필터케이스(3)의 공기유입측(31)은 실내로 돌출되도록 장착되어 실내공기를 실외로 배출시키는 작동으로 실내를 환기시키도록 설치되는 것이다.In the ventilator 1 of the present invention, the front surface 22 of the case 2 to which the ventilating fan 21 is mounted is exposed to the outside, and the air inflow side 31 of the filter case 3 is installed to protrude into the room, And is installed to ventilate the room by an operation of discharging air outdoors.

먼저, 도 1에 도시된 실시예의 환풍기(1)에 대하여 설명한다.First, the ventilator 1 of the embodiment shown in Fig. 1 will be described.

상기 환풍기(1)를 가동시키게 되면 환풍팬(21)이 회전작동하게 되므로 케이스(2)의 이면(23)을 통해 공기를 흡입하여 전면(22)으로 배출시키게 되는데, 이때 상기 케이스(2)의 이면(23)에 장착된 필터케이스(3)는 실내로 돌출되어 있으므로 상기 환풍팬(21)의 회전작동시 케이스(2)의 이면(23)측으로 흡입되는 공기는 상기한 이면(23)에 장착된 필터케이스(3)의 공기유입측(31)으로 흡입되는 실내공기인 것이다.When the ventilator 1 is operated, the ventilating fan 21 is rotated. Accordingly, the ventilator 1 sucks air through the back 23 of the case 2 and discharges the air to the front 22. At this time, The filter case 3 mounted on the back surface 23 protrudes into the room so that the air sucked into the back surface 23 of the case 2 during the rotation operation of the ventilation fan 21 is mounted on the back surface 23 Is the indoor air sucked into the air inflow side (31) of the filter case (3).

상기와 같이 환풍기(1)의 가동시 필터케이스(3)의 공기유입측(31)으로 흡입되는 실내 공기는 상기 공기유입측(31)에 근접하도록 장착된 프리필터(4)를 통과하는 과정에서 흡입되는 공기에 포함되어 있는 먼지 등의 이물질이 여과되는 것이며, 상기 프리필터(4)를 통과한 공기는 블랙라이트등(5)에서 발광하는 자외선에 노출되는 상태가 되며, 이와 같이 상기 프리필터(4)를 통과하는 공기는 블랙라이트등(6)이 장착된 공간을 통과하는 과정에서 자외선에 노출되어 살균처리되는 것이다.The indoor air sucked into the air inflow side 31 of the filter case 3 during the operation of the ventilator 1 passes through the prefilter 4 attached to the air inflow side 31, The air that has passed through the pre-filter 4 is exposed to the ultraviolet light emitted from the black light lamp 5, and the pre-filter (not shown) 4 is exposed to ultraviolet rays in the process of passing through the space in which the black light lamp 6 is mounted and sterilized.

또한 상기 블랙라이트등(6)에서 발광하는 자외선에 노출되어 살균처리된 공기는 허니컴 구조로 된 광촉매필터(6)를 통과하는 과정에서 공기에 포함되어 있는 유해물질이 산화 및 분해되므로 결국 상기 광촉매필터(6)를 통과하는 공기에는 먼지 등의 이물질이 제거되고, 유해물질이 살균처리 및 산화분해처리되는 것이다.The harmful substances contained in the air are oxidized and decomposed in the course of passing through the photocatalytic filter 6 having a honeycomb structure after the air sterilized and exposed to ultraviolet rays emitted from the black light lamp 6, The foreign matter such as dust is removed from the air passing through the air passage 6, and the harmful substance is subjected to the sterilization treatment and the oxidative decomposition treatment.

따라서 상기 환풍기(1)를 가동하게 되면 환풍팬(21)의 회전작동에 의해 실내의 오염된 공기가 필터케이스(3)의 공기유입측(31)으로 흡입되어 그 내부를 통과하는 과정에서 공기에 포함되어 있는 먼지 등의 이물질이 제거되고, 유해물질은 살균처리 및 산화분해되어 깨끗하게 정화된 상태로 실외에 배출되므로 실외의 대기환경을 오염시키지 않으면서 실내의 오염된 공기를 환기시킬 수 있게 되는 것이다.Therefore, when the ventilator 1 is operated, the contaminated air in the room is sucked into the air inflow side 31 of the filter case 3 by the rotation operation of the ventilating fan 21, The foreign substances such as dust are removed and the harmful substances are discharged to the outside in a clean and purified state by sterilization and oxidation and decomposition, so that the polluted air in the room can be ventilated without polluting the outside air environment .

다음, 도 2에 도시된 실시예의 환풍기(1)는 필터케이스(3)의 내부에는 공기유입측(31)에서 케이스(2)의 이면(23)을 향해 프리필터(4), 블랙라이트등(5), 광촉매필터(6) 및 셀라이트 필터(7)가 차례대로 형성된 4단 구조로 형성되어 있는데, 상기한 프리필터(4), 블랙라이트등(5), 광촉매필터(6) 등은 전술한 실시예(도 1 참조)와 같은 작용을 하게 되므로 이에 대한 설명은 생략하며, 상기 광촉매필터(6)를 통과하는 공기는 셀라이트 필터(7)를 통과하는 과정에서 악취와 같은 냄새가 탈취 및 정화되어 케이스(2)의 전면(22)으로 배출되는 것이다.Next, the ventilator 1 of the embodiment shown in Fig. 2 is provided with a prefilter 4, a black light or the like (not shown) from the air inflow side 31 to the back side 23 of the case 2 in the filter case 3 The pre-filter 4, the black light lamp 5, the photocatalyst filter 6, and the like are formed in a four-tier structure in which the photocatalyst filter 6, the celite filter 7, And the air passing through the photocatalytic filter 6 is passed through the Celite filter 7, so that the odor, such as odor, And is discharged to the front surface 22 of the case 2.

따라서 도 2 실시예의 환풍기(1)는 실내의 오염된 공기에 포함되어 있는 먼지 등의 이물질을 제거하고, 공기에 포함되어 있는 유해물질을 살균처리 및 산화분해 처리하며, 나아가 공기에 포함되어 있는 악취와 같은 냄새를 탈취 및 정화하여 실외로 배출시키게 되므로 실내의 오염된 공기를 환기시킬 때 실외의 대기환경을 오염시키지 않도록 하면서 실내의 공기를 환기시킬 수 있게 되는 것이다.
Accordingly, the ventilator 1 of the embodiment of FIG. 2 removes foreign matter such as dust contained in the contaminated air in the room, disinfects and oxidizes and treats harmful substances contained in the air, So that the air in the room can be ventilated while polluting the polluted air in the room without polluting the outdoor air environment.
